Army Suspends Aircrew for Unauthorized Flights Near Kid Rock's Home
The incident raises concerns about military aircraft operations over private residences.
Apr. 1, 2026 at 1:09am
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
The U.S. Army has suspended an aircrew after they were found to have flown military helicopters over the private residence of musician Kid Rock in Oklahoma City. The unauthorized flights, which occurred on multiple occasions, have prompted an investigation and disciplinary action against the personnel involved.

The details
According to the report, the aircrew was conducting training flights in the Oklahoma City area when they were observed making unauthorized passes over Kid Rock's home. The Army has confirmed that the flights violated established procedures and that the personnel responsible have been suspended pending further investigation.
- The unauthorized flights occurred on multiple occasions in recent months.
- The Army launched an investigation into the incident on March 28, 2026.
